This Easter was an unusual one because of the Chinese Virus, but it was still fun. Some things were quite different and others were the same. It was definitely a special kind of Easter, even though I couldn’t visit my friends or family.

How was it different?

Easter was very different this year in many ways. First, I couldn’t visit my family in New Hampshire. Also, we had to buy our Easter dinner instead of having Meme cook the dinner herself (she’s like a cooking machine, if you catch my drift). Another thing that was different was the Easter dessert. We had to eat cake from the restaurant instead of Meme making her famous pies.

Family eating tasty cake

What was the same?

Easter was also a little bit similar to previous years in some ways. For instance, we still had an Easter Egg Hunt (even though the eggs were filled with money instead of candy). We also got Easter baskets full of candy and toys. Another similarity was that we still got to see our family, even though it was on a video app called Zoom.

Final thoughts about Easter Virus

This Easter, we got toys like Legos and Dragamonz and other stuff. We got money from our Easter eggs (I got $12.00, but my brother got $0.78 more than me). We also spent time with our family. So, I guess maybe it was a pretty good Easter after all.
